一、生鲜App界面个性化设计核心原则
1. 视觉吸引力
- 色彩搭配:以自然色系为主(如绿色、橙色、木色),传递新鲜、健康的品牌印象。
- 图标与插画:使用手绘风格或扁平化图标,增强亲和力;关键页面(如首页、分类页)可加入动态插画提升趣味性。
- 图片质量:高清商品图+场景化展示(如食材烹饪过程),激发用户购买欲。
2. 交互逻辑优化
- 简化流程:一键加购、智能推荐、语音搜索等功能减少操作步骤。
- 个性化推荐:基于用户历史行为(浏览、购买、收藏)推送定制化商品列表。
- 动态反馈:加载动画、操作成功提示等微交互提升用户体验。
3. 品牌差异化
- 定制化组件:通过源码修改导航栏、标签页、弹窗等模块样式,匹配品牌VI。
- 节日/活动主题:快速切换皮肤(如春节红、中秋黄),增强节日氛围。
二、万象源码部署方案
假设“万象源码”为可二次开发的生鲜App框架(如基于React Native/Flutter的跨平台方案),部署流程如下:
1. 源码获取与环境搭建
- 获取源码:从官方渠道下载或购买授权版本,确保代码完整性。
- 开发环境:
- 前端:安装Node.js、React Native CLI或Flutter SDK。
- 后端:配置服务器(如Nginx+MySQL/MongoDB),部署API接口。
- 依赖管理:通过`npm`或`pub`安装项目依赖库。
2. 界面个性化定制
- 主题配置:
- 修改`src/themes/`目录下的样式文件(如颜色变量、字体大小)。
- 示例:将默认主题色` FF6B6B`改为品牌绿` 4CAF50`。
- 组件替换:
- 自定义导航栏:修改`AppNavigator.js`,调整底部TabBar图标和布局。
- 商品卡片:在`ProductCard.js`中增加“限时抢购”标签或3D翻转效果。
- 动态皮肤切换:
- 实现主题管理功能,用户可在设置中选择不同皮肤,数据存储于本地或云端。
3. 功能扩展与优化
- 个性化推荐算法:
- 集成协同过滤或基于内容的推荐系统,通过源码调用后端API更新推荐列表。
- AR试吃功能(可选):
- 使用ARKit/ARCore插件,在商品详情页展示食材3D模型,增强互动性。
- 多语言支持:
- 修改`i18n`配置文件,添加多语言包(如中英文切换)。
4. 测试与部署
- 兼容性测试:
- 在iOS/Android不同设备上测试界面显示效果,修复布局错乱问题。
- 性能优化:
- 压缩图片资源,使用WebP格式减少加载时间。
- 代码分割(Code Splitting)优化首屏加载速度。
- 发布上线:
- 生成iOS(.ipa)和Android(.apk)安装包,提交至App Store和Google Play。
三、关键技术点
1. 跨平台开发:
- 使用React Native/Flutter实现“一次开发,多端适配”,降低维护成本。
2. 状态管理:
- 采用Redux(React Native)或Provider(Flutter)管理全局状态,确保UI与数据同步。
3. API对接:
- 通过Axios/Dio调用后端接口,实现商品列表、订单状态等实时更新。
4. 数据分析:
- 集成Firebase/Google Analytics,跟踪用户行为,优化设计决策。
四、案例参考
- 盒马鲜生:
- 界面以蓝色为主色调,搭配动态海鲜插画,突出“新鲜直达”概念。
- 通过LBS技术实现“30分钟达”标签可视化,增强用户信任感。
- 每日优鲜:
- 采用卡片式布局,商品图占比高,配合“限时秒杀”倒计时提升转化率。
- 个性化推荐栏根据用户偏好动态调整商品顺序。
五、注意事项
- 版权合规:确保使用的图片、字体、插件等素材已获得授权。
- 安全性:对用户数据(如地址、支付信息)进行加密传输,符合GDPR等法规。
- 持续迭代:根据用户反馈定期更新界面(如新增“食谱推荐”板块),保持竞争力。
通过万象源码的灵活定制,生鲜App可快速实现从“功能完整”到“审美独特”的升级,同时降低开发成本。建议结合A/B测试验证设计效果,持续优化用户体验。